Political objectives in Oslo 50 % reduction in emissions of greenhouse gases by 2030 50 % recovery of materials by 2014 Source sorting of food waste and plastic packaging by 2012 Increased use of renewable energy: Decision of sustainable cycle of waste handling, energy recycling and District heating in Oslo (1-2 TWh.) Change from fossil fuels to renewable waste-based fuel for the district heating system. Use biogas as renewable fuel in vehicles
Oslo and EGE in a climate perspective Based on the political objectives, Oslo has defined the scope of work in EGEs building programme : Scope of work, EGE: New Waste-to-energy line, Klemetsrud KA3 Optical sorting plant at Haraldrud Optical sorting plant at Klemetsrud Biogas plant at Nes in Romerike
Circular Waste Management in Oslo The climate perspective, realised through circular waste management Circular waste management is based on total recovery of materials and energy that waste, as a resource, represents. EGE s new plants at Klemetsrud and Haraldrud have been developed in pursuance of this perspective, focusing on production of renewable energy, such as district heating, electricity and biogas, and the best possible materials recovery from food waste.

Biogas plant: From food waste to biogas and biofertilizer Biogas plant
Environment and Climate Aspects Using biogas as fuel offers global environmental benefits, as this replaces and reduces fossil CO2 emissions and recuce local emissions. Nitrogen and phosphorus are nonrenewable resources, which are in short supply on a global scale. Proper use of bio fertilizer will return these nutrients to the ground.

Main Supplies for the KA, Line 3 Contractor: Von Roll Inova AE&E Inova Hitachi Zosen Inova Automatic waste reception system with fully automatic waste cranes (Kranwerke) Boiler/incinerator unit Wet Flue Gas Treatment System with SCR catalytic NO x reduction Turbine/Generator (Man Turbo AG) Waste Water Treatments System Regulation coolers to cool excess heat production during summer time.
Energy Production Overall energy efficiency: 99 % Nominal electrical efficiency 20% Maximum electrical efficiency 24% Nominal energy production: 55,4 MW heat corresponding to heat demand for 40.000 households 10,5 MW electricity corresponding to electricity consumption for 20.000 households
